Microsoft Deploys Emergency Patch for Critical Windows 11 Recovery Environment Failure

Microsoft has issued an emergency out-of-band update for Windows 11 after a recent security patch caused critical failures in the Windows Recovery Environment. The issue prevented keyboard and mouse functionality, making recovery tools completely inaccessible for affected users. The mandatory update is automatically deploying to all Windows 11 24H2 and 25H2 systems.

Critical System Failure Prompts Emergency Response

Microsoft has deployed an emergency update for Windows 11 following what reports describe as a “total disaster” stemming from a recent mandatory security patch. According to sources, the problematic update caused severe breakdowns in the Windows Recovery Environment (WinRE), preventing keyboards and mice from functioning and rendering recovery tools completely unusable.

OpenAI Debuts ChatGPT Atlas Browser, Reportedly Impacting Alphabet Stock

OpenAI has unveiled ChatGPT Atlas, a new web browser integrating AI capabilities directly into browsing. The announcement reportedly coincided with Alphabet shares declining over 2% during Tuesday trading as analysts monitor competitive implications.

OpenAI Enters Browser Market with ChatGPT Atlas

OpenAI announced the launch of its ChatGPT Atlas web browser during a livestream event Tuesday, according to reports. The new browser represents the company’s expansion beyond conversational AI into the competitive web browser space, with sources indicating it’s initially available on MacOS with Windows, iOS, and Android versions expected soon.

Google Unveils Android XR App Ecosystem Ahead of Samsung Headset Debut

Google has quietly launched a dedicated Play Store section for Android XR apps just hours before Samsung’s Galaxy XR headset announcement. The platform showcases titles like Asteroid and Vacation Simulator, with reports suggesting PC streaming capabilities. Samsung’s device, codenamed Project Moohan, is expected to be the first to run the new operating system.

Android XR Platform Revealed Through Play Store Update

Google has provided the first substantial look at its Android XR platform through a newly launched Play Store section, according to reports from Android Authority. The discovery came just hours before Samsung’s scheduled Galaxy extended reality headset announcement, suggesting coordinated timing between the technology partners. The dedicated section titled “immersive experiences made for your XR headset” showcases several apps and games specifically designed for the upcoming platform.

Critical Windows SMB Vulnerability Actively Exploited Despite Patch Availability

Federal cybersecurity officials confirm active exploitation of a high-severity Windows SMB vulnerability months after Microsoft released patches. The flaw, rated 8.8 on the CVSS scale, enables attackers to escalate privileges and move laterally within compromised networks. Organizations are urged to apply June 2025 security updates immediately.

Active Exploitation Confirmed

The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ency (CISA) has confirmed that a high-severity vulnerability in Microsoft’s Windows SMB client is now being actively exploited in the wild, according to reports. The flaw, tracked as CVE-2025-33073, was added to CISA’s Known Exploited Vulnerabilities catalog on October 20, indicating that threat actors are successfully leveraging the vulnerability in ongoing campaigns despite patches being available since June 2025.
